About this ebook

Newly expanded and revised, May 2021

In this latest edition covering Nik Color Efex Pro 4, landscape photographer Robin Whalley explains how to make the most of this powerful and versatile photo editor. In his usual straightforward style, he carefully guides you through using Nik Color Efex Pro 4 as both a plugin and standalone photo editor.

After explaining the many features and how you might use them, the 55 Color Efex Pro filters are described in full. Each filter and its controls are detailed, together with usage tips and advice for combining the different filters.

You will learn how to:

·        Use and manage Control Points to make complex selections and adjustments with ease.

·        Integrate Nik Color Efex Pro 4 into your workflow as either a Plugin or standalone editor.

·        Combine multiple filters to greatly improve your editing results.

·        Apply the non-destructive workflow introduced in the Nik Collection 3 by DxO.

·        Work with the Nik Selective Tool in Photoshop.

At the end of the book are four full length editing examples using only Nik Color Efex Pro 4. The examples demonstrate how to use the software to transform ordinary colour photography and elevate it to a new level. The starting images are available to download on the authors website, allowing you to follow the examples on your own computer.

This comprehensive book assumes no prior knowledge of Nik Color Efex Pro 4 and is ideal for both the beginning and intermediate Nik user. It covers all versions of Nik Color Efex Pro 4 up to and including the version in the Nik Collection 3 by DxO.

About the author

Robin Whalley is a Landscape Photographer with a passion for software, image editing and a skill for sharing knowledge. He has been honing his photography skills since 2000 starting first with film before moving quickly to digital. He now speaks at Camera Clubs and Photographic Societies throughout the North West of England where he likes to share his insights into how to create engaging photography.
